Power
supply
circuit
9.
The oscillator has a mains transformer and a full-wave rectifier circuit, feeding the
instrument
through
a series regulating circuit employing p-n-p transistors
VTl
to
VT4.
10.
On the mains transformer T1 are two primary windings which can be linked in series or
parallel to permit operation from a. c. supplies giving between 190
V
and
260 V
or between
9i> V
and 130
V
respectively.
11.
Terminals and switch S2
at
the rear
allow
the input of the regulating circuit to be fed from
an external d. c.
source.
A series semiconductor diode MR1 protects the
instrument
against
the application of the wrong polarity.
MONITORED
A
TTENUA TOR
12.
The monitored
attenuator
consists
(Fig.
2)
of a
111
dB
step
attenuator,
an
input voltmeter
and an output circuit including a multi-ratio matching transformer.
Step attenuator
13.
The
step attenuator
provides
a range of
111
dB
in
three decades.
The three
controls of
these
permit adjustment in steps of
10
dB
from 0
up
to
100
dB,
in
steps of
1
dB
from
0
to 10 dB,
and
in
steps of 0.
1
dB from
0
to 1 dB.
The
last two
decades
can
also be
switched
to completely
break
the
signal
path through the instrument.
14.
Each decac
~uses
four symmetrical T
networks,
which
are
switched
into use
alone or
in
different series combinations to
provide
ten steps of attenuation.
Each network
has a charac-
teristic
impedance
of 600
n.
High-stability resistors are
used
throughout.
The complete step
attenuator assembly is in a separate box.
